Output 8e33f6b7f8484078b42d0dc7d7b4dbaa32cd59f17075ecff366d0b1f30e18f1c:18

value
67729
script pubkey
OP_0 OP_PUSHBYTES_20 650e43697dbbc40be98600d398bede775b8e52f8
address
bc1qv58yx6tah0zqh6vxqrfe30k7wadcu5hchj49yz
transaction
8e33f6b7f8484078b42d0dc7d7b4dbaa32cd59f17075ecff366d0b1f30e18f1c
confirmations
113973
spent
true